John Newton (1725–1807)

Words: John New­ton, Ol­ney Hymns (Lon­don: W. Ol­iv­er, 1779), Book 1, num­ber 116. The re­sur­rec­tion and the life.

Music: Abid­ing Grace John S. Camp, 1905 (🔊 pdf nwc).

Lyrics

I am, saith Christ, our glo­ri­ous head
(May we at­tent­ion give),
“The re­sur­rect­ion of the dead,
The life of all that live.

“By faith in Me, the soul re­ceives
New life, though dead be­fore;
And he that in My name be­lieves,
Shall live, to die no more.

The sin­ner, sleep­ing in his grave,
Shall at My voice awake;
And when I once begin to save,
My work I ne’er for­sake.

Fulfill Thy pro­mise, gra­cious Lord,
On us as­sem­bled here;
Put forth Thy spi­rit with the Word,
And cause the dead to hear.

Preserve the pow­er of faith alive,
In those who love Thy name;
For sin and Sa­tan dai­ly strive
To quench the sac­red flame.

Thy pow­er and mer­cy first pre­vailed,
From death to set us free;
And oft­en since our life had failed
If not re­newed by Thee.

To Thee we look, to Thee we bow;
To Thee for help we call;
Our life and re­sur­rect­ion Thou,
Our hope, our joy, our all.
